Didn't quite reach my goal of 15 miles today but perhaps that's asking too much after a week of ITBS recovery and then only two back to back 6 mile days. On the other hand, both my legs feel perfectly fine after today's run. Took some time to reinvent my stride and I think it's working. ITBS and other aches and pains associated with inflammed innards are totally absent. Used much more energy than normal doing this though...that and the sun was a bit brutal this afternoon.
On the other hand, around mile 10 and definitely by mile 11, I stopped being able to generate much energy. Probably because I didn't have enough carbs earlier in the day but what stopped me today wasn't my legs. I just could no longer breathe properly and everything became labored. My stomach also felt like it was trying to digest itself. Definitely one of the hardest runs I've done but a great learning experience. If I can hit 16-ish Thursday and 20-ish Sunday, I'll be a bit more confident about being able to finish the marathon.
And speaking of learning experiences: never run with boxer briefs (I forgot to change into briefs today). Holy chafeage Batman!
